BMW Motorrad Reveals 2022 Motorcycle Range

BMW Motorrad recently took the wraps off its 2022 motorcycle range, with most models getting significant updates. Here's a lowdown on the updates that the models sold in India receive. We are likely to see these updates offered on models sold in India.

BMW Motorrad has updated its motorcycle line-up for 2022. Most models receive updates in form of new colour schemes being introduced, old colour schemes being dropped, new features added and so on. The BMW S 1000 R gets the maximum updates, with the M Chassis kit being standard. This includes a swinging pivot point with rear lift. The optional sports package on the superbike has been dropped and it now gets a race package with M endurance chain, sports silencer or M Titanium exhaust. The dynamic package now includes updated riding modes pro, heated grips, cruise control and DDC. And like before, the motorcycle also gets the M package which includes M Sport wheels/ M carbon wheels, GSP laptrigger, lightweight battery and M Sport seat. Lastly, the 2022 S 1000 RR gets a new colour scheme called 'Passion with Mineral Grey metallic'.

BMW R 18

(The 2022 BMW R 18 gets a bunch of new colour options. Seen here is the Mars red metallic)

The BMW R 18 cruiser motorcycle too gets new colour schemes which are Mars red metallic, Manhattan metallic matt and Option 719 Galaxy Dust metallic/Titanium silver2 metallic along with chrome package for all colour options. BMW has also dropped the first edition of the R 18. Customers can also choose to get the BMW Options 719 aero package which includes cylinder head covers and front covers made of brushed Aluminium. We expect to see the new colours in India as well.

BMW F 900 R

(The updated 2022 BMW F 900 R is likely to be launched in India later this year)

The 2022 BMW F 900 R gets two new colour schemes which are 'New Style Exclusive with Blue stone metallic' and New Style Sport with Light white /Racing blue metallic/Racing red. The latter colour also comes with an engine spoiler. BMW has discontinued offering a pillion seat cover along with two older colours which are San Marino Blue and Hockenheim Silver.

BMW F 900 XR

(The 2022 BMW F 900 XR gets a new all-black colour scheme)

For 2022, the BMW F 900 XR gets a new colour which is 'New Style Triple Black with Black storm metallic. The new models get hand-guard as standard as well. The 'Style Exclusive with Galvanic Gold metallic' colour has been dropped.

BMW S 1000 XR

(The 2022 BMW S 1000 XR gets a new M Motorsport colour scheme for the first time ever)

The S 1000 XR gets three new colours which are New Style Triple Black with Black storm metallic 2, Racing red 2 and Light white/M Motorsport. The M Package can be opted for only with the Light white/M Motorsport colour, which is offered on the S 1000 XR for the first time. BMW has also dropped four colours which are Ice Grey, Racing red /White Aluminium metallic matt and Light white/Racing blue metallic/Racing red.
